Can 2022 Lexus RC 350 rotors be resurfaced or do they need to be replaced?

Resurfacing is only acceptable if the 2022 Lexus RC 350 rotor remains above its stamped minimum thickness; otherwise replacement is required.

Our technicians mic the rotor and check lateral runout before deciding. Many modern rotors reach the resurface threshold quickly, so measuring against the “MIN TH” spec on the rotor hat is essential. Do I need to replace rotors when I replace pads on a 2022 Lexus RC 350?

Not always—rotors on a 2022 Lexus RC 350 only need replacement if below minimum thickness or if surfaces are heat-checked, grooved, or out-of-round.

We measure thickness and inspect the faces to decide whether to resurface (if safely above spec) or replace. Keeping good rotors reduces cost and maintains OEM brake feel. What are the signs of bad rotors on a 2022 Lexus RC 350?

Common signs include brake pulsation at speed, steering wheel shake when stopping, deep grooves, blue heat marks, and rotors worn below the “MIN TH” spec.

If you feel vibration during highway braking or see scoring on the rotor face, it’s time for an inspection. Our Hingham team measures thickness and runout, then shows you readings and photos. Why are my 2022 Lexus RC 350 rotors warping in Hingham?

Most “warping” is uneven pad material transfer or rotor thickness variation from heat, hard stops, or holding the brake at a hot stop.

Repeated high-heat events can print pad material onto the rotor, creating a pulsation feel. Corrosion at the hub-to-rotor surface can also induce runout. What’s Included in a 2022 Lexus RC 350 Rotor Replacement

Your visit starts with a precise brake inspection: we measure rotor thickness at multiple points and check lateral runout against manufacturer limits. If replacement is warranted, our team removes the caliper and rotor, cleans the hub-to-rotor mating surface to bare metal, and installs an OEM-spec rotor. Hardware is replaced or serviced as needed, pad condition is verified, and we check brake fluid level and condition. After reassembly, we perform a correct bedding-in procedure to stabilize friction and reduce the chance of pulsation, then complete a road test and torque recheck.
